Thanks, and what is your goal for the A1264 Express? What do you want it to do? What service will it perform on the network?
Trying to expand wifi to other areas of my home where signal is weak or not at all
Temporarily, locate the A1264 Express in the same room as the other Express.
Power up the A1264 for a full minute
Then, hold in the reset button on the Express for 10 seconds and release
Allow a full minute for the Express to restart
The A1264 will be slowly blinking amber at this time
On your Mac.....open Macintosh HD > Applications > Utilities > AirPort Utility
Click on Other WiFi Devices
Click on AirPort Express
The utility will open up automatically and take a minute to analyze the network, then suggest that the A1264 will extend the other AirPort Express network
Type in a simple name that you want to call the A1264 Express and click Next
The utility will set things up for you. When you see the message of Setup Complete, click Done
Now move the A1264 Express to a location that is no more than half way between the "main" Express and the general area that needs more wireless coverage and power up the A1264.
The more that you have line of sight between the AirPorts, the better the network will operate.
